Output ed6ba0ace5110f74b231d09317dc66ff95b8336847f6e13f35a8e667762245fe:5

value
14870869
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 83fec76323378586a67b90ca45290bb3293871ff OP_EQUALVERIFY OP_CHECKSIG
address
1D2vjUZ9v1QCHbW3HSreNjDNAEhVEUEqe3
transaction
ed6ba0ace5110f74b231d09317dc66ff95b8336847f6e13f35a8e667762245fe
spent
true